There are many types of real … WebFixed deposits are investments predominantly deposited with banks. It yields fixed interest income and the original investment money is repaid to the deposit holder at maturity. Example: Mr. B deposited $1 Million in XY bank which pays 10% interest per annum. This is a one-year deposit plan.

WebFeb 23, 2024 · This risk prevails almost in all debt market securities. For example, Varun invested at a time when there was 7% fixed interest rate, but after a month the market fluctuated and the interest rate rose to 10%. In such a situation, Varun lost on to higher interest rates and will get only the fixed interest rate. 3.
